Rocking the Vote: Which Music Stars are Turning Out for Which Candidates?

Stevie Wonder, Bruce Springsteen, Kid Rock all turn out in support of their candidates

 

By Alex Baker

 

Bill Clinton’s 1992 successful bid for the White House may have been the first modern presidential campaign to feature a rock and roll theme song – Fleetwood Mac‘s “Don’t Stop (Thinking About Tomorrow).” In the two decades that have ensued since then, rock and politics have become evermore intertwined.
